Subject: DR drill follow-up — conversion rounding

Team, during yesterday's Harbrook disaster-recovery drill we confirmed the rounding errors in currency conversion stem from truncation in the Pennywise module, not data loss. Failover itself was clean. Support should reference this when closing related tickets. To access the drill's recovery environment, use the passphrase provided below.

vault phrase of bagaf-kajeg = jorath-feniel-briir-siliel-ralix

Welcome to the Tollgate payments team! Heads up: our integration tests are a bit flaky — the Ledgerling sandbox sometimes times out, so a red build isn't always your fault. Retry once before panicking, and tag anything that fails twice. To run the full suite locally you'll need to sign the test harness bundle, using the key below.

rollout seal: bky4_DFM9

Quick note on the Crumbline order-cutoff rule before you review the PR: orders for next-day pickup close at 18:00 bakery-local time, not UTC, which is why the scheduler does that timezone lookup per store. If a store has no timezone row, we fall back to the region default and log a warning. Don't "fix" that fallback — the Millhaven stores rely on it. To sanity-check cutoff rows yourself, connect to the orders database with the string below.

primary connection of yajop-yagug = mssql://briael_svc:vT1Pr9XtvSg1Kl@db-bbe8.qirvangrid.internal:5432/gilmir

[ ] Websocket compression tradeoffs — for the eng sync. We flipped on permessage-deflate in Sockline staging and saw ~60% bandwidth savings but a noticeable CPU bump on the edge nodes, plus some memory churn from per-connection contexts. Proposal: enable it only for payloads over 1 KB. Let's decide before Thursday's cut. Benchmarks ran against the candidate build, whose token is noted below.

session token of tajef-bageg = htk21_5d90d574934f3ccae6437